WCM Forum

WCM Forum (http://www.wcm.at/forum/index.php)
-   Programmierung (http://www.wcm.at/forum/forumdisplay.php?f=17)
-   -   hilfe in vbscript (http://www.wcm.at/forum/showthread.php?t=234809)

tabi 25.05.2009 13:37

hilfe in vbscript
 
hallo leute.

bräuchte mal bitte eure hilfe. hab hier eine variable "phonenumber" als string definiert. da sollen telefonnummern drinnen stehen. jetzt hätte ich welche, die aber alle mit leerzeichen sind. "+43 664 3333 333" usw... wie kann ich diese leerzeichen entfernen? trim hab ich im google gefunden

bsp: retval="phonenumber" (so stehts momentan im code) wie soll ich die funktion einbauen?

danke im voraus...

FranzK 25.05.2009 14:29

Versuche es einmal so:

NeuerString = REPLACE (AlterString, " ", "")

:hallo:

tabi 25.05.2009 16:23

danke für die info. damit könnte ich die vorhandenen ersetzen. aber neue nummern werden wieder per leerzeichen kommen. da es sich um eine schnittstelle handelt, wo die infos vom active directory eingelesen werden. und wie gesagt, momentan steht dort nur RETVAL="PHONENUMBER". also müsste ich es dort gleich anpassen, dass die leerzeichen gefiltert werden.

hoffe ich hab mich verständlich ausdrücken können.

FranzK 25.05.2009 16:36

Nein.

:hallo:

tabi 25.05.2009 16:40

okay, ich hab eine schnittstelle, die mit dem ad kooperiert, und die infos dann in die anwendung übernimmt. momentan kommen alle einträge mit einem leerzeichen in die anwendung, da die variable einfach ohne etwas da steht. und die schnittstelle die daten genau so übernimmt, wie sie im ad drinnen stehen. wie muss ich in der schnittstelle die variable definieren, dass die leerzeichen gleich weggelassen werden, ohne dass sie in die anwendung kommen?

retval=trim (phonenumber) .... so in der art etwas oder?

FranzK 25.05.2009 16:46

Ich verstehe nicht, wo dein Problem liegt. Was spricht gegen:

TEMPRETVAL = "PHONENUMBER"
RETVAL = REPLACE (TEMPRETVAL, " ", "")

:hallo:

tabi 25.05.2009 16:51

hmmm, probier ich mal aus.

danke für deine hilfe!!!


Alle Zeitangaben in WEZ +2. Es ist jetzt 19:29 Uhr.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
© 2009 FSL Verlag